Can an emergency locksmith make a key from a lock cylinder without the original?
Yes, a skilled emergency locksmith can create a key from just the lock cylinder—this is called impressioning or key reading. They examine the internal pin positions and create a matching key, usually within 15-30 minutes depending on the lock type.
How it works: The locksmith uses special tools to read the depth of the pins inside the cylinder or makes a soft metal blank that captures the pin impressions. They then cut a new key based on those measurements. This works well for standard residential and commercial locks.
Cost & limitations: Emergency service calls typically run $75–$150+ depending on your location, time of day, and lock complexity. High-security or specialized locks may take longer or cost more. Some locks are harder to impression (certain deadbolts, keyway designs), so the locksmith will let you know if it's feasible upfront.
